Compare and contrast the immigrants experience of angel island and ellis island

History
2 answers:
Valentin [98]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Explanation:

the immigrants at Ellis Island were treated more equally than those at Angel Island.The main ethnic groups that came through Ellis Island were English, Irish, Italian, and Polish. angel island. Immigrants at Angel Island were not treated fairly.and were mainly from Asian countries such as china, japan, and India and the Chinese were targeted due to the large influx of immigrants that were arriving in the United States.To enter immigrants had to prove that they were healthy and show that they had money, a skill, or sponsor to provide for them. Ellis Island was welcoming to some, Angel Island was always formidable and seemingly designed to filter out Chinese immigrants.

Why was Texas a source of conflict between the United States and Mexico?
frozen [14]
<span>There were several causes of the conflict between the American settlers and Mexico. First, Mexico feared that they would lose Texas to the United States, so they started enforcing laws that had been ignored. Then, Santa Anna gained power and became a dictator. There were rumors that Santa Anna wanted to drive Americans out of Texas. Americans wanted to overthrow Santa Anna, so this started fighting.</span>
